Scores of cartoons from the Daily Mail's classic Fred Basset strip, featuring one of the most endearing and enduring of Britain's cartoon heroes. An authority on slipper gnawing, newspaper collection and postman harassment, Fred Basset and his lugubrious wisecracks now grace publications worldwide.

Alexander S. Graham (1913-1991) was a British cartoonist who created the comic strip, Fred Basset.
